Port operator Pelabuhan Indonesia III (Pelindo III) had a debt capital markets debut to remember on September 24, with a blowout $500m 4.875% 10 year transaction that was close to 16 times subscribed.

China’s Datang Telecom Technology sold its inaugural international bond on Monday September 22. Although forces of nature delayed the launch of the unrated three year offshore renminbi issue, the deal ultimately drew a very warm response from investors.

Zhejiang Provincial Energy (ZPE) sold the first dollar bond from a provincial level Chinese state owned enterprise on Tuesday. Buoyed by ZPE’s credit strength and Zhejiang province’s strong fiscal position, the three year issue was a hit among investors and sets a solid foundation for the emergence of similar credits in the dollar market, writes Isabella Zhong.

Japanese brewer Suntory Holdings left a solid footprint in the dollar market with its inaugural issue on Wednesday. With books for the RegS/144A $1bn dual tranche issue already covered during Asia trading hours, dealers proceeded to push final pricing 20bp tighter than where investor feedback came in.

China Longyuan Power Group raised $500m with a three year paper that was issued by subsidiary Hero Asia Investment on Wednesday. Earlier this month the state owned borrower received approval to start preliminary work on two large wind farm projects in China’s Guangxi province.

China’s Geely Automotive Holdings opened books for its inaugural international issue on Wednesday. The car maker is offering a Reg S/144A five year non call three dollar bond.
